Quick note for the weekly sync: we're load testing the Cartwheel checkout flow ahead of the Bramblefest sale. The harness spins up 5k virtual shoppers against staging, ramping over ten minutes, and we watch payment-intent latency plus cart-abandon errors. If p95 creeps past 800ms, we flag it and stop the ramp. Don't run tests against prod, obviously. Dashboards, ramp schedules, and how to claim a test slot are all documented on the page below.

dashboard of fajop-badug = https://jira.qorvelsys.internal/pages/pages/pages/display

Account Recovery — Trace Hops First. Before you unlock anything in Lanternbay, pull the trace ID from the gateway and follow it through auth-core, profile-svc, and mailer. If any hop dropped the span, treat the request as suspect and escalate. Once the trace checks out end-to-end, approve the reset using the passphrase below.

vault phrase of yagag-kadup = belael-druius-rusax-kelox

Release checklist — PortionPal recipe-scaling calculator, item 7 of 12. Reviewer: please double-check the fraction rounding before you approve. Last release, scaling a recipe by 1.5x turned "1/3 cup" into a nonsense decimal, and the Breadmoor beta testers noticed immediately. Run the scaling snapshot tests, eyeball the unit-conversion table for metric mode, and confirm the "halve recipe" shortcut still floors egg counts sensibly. If all that looks good, sign off and note the build token below in your approval comment.

session token of tajef-bageg = htk21_5d90d574934f3ccae6437

This page covers the environment variables that control sharding for the Lanternvale profile store, discussed at last week's sync. PROFILE_SHARD_COUNT must match the ring size recorded in the topology doc; changing it without a rebalance will strand records. PROFILE_SHARD_STRATEGY accepts hash or range; we run hash everywhere except the Kestrel cluster. Set both in the service's .env, keeping the ordering shown in the template. The shard-coordinator auth secret goes on the line immediately after these two.

sealed setting: RELAY_SECRET5=82864